Welcome to the journey of Vie Maestre, a project that weaves together slow tourism, local identity, and the promotion of artisanal excellence. Promoted by Confartigianato Imprese Marca Trevigiana, with the financial support of the Chamber of Commerce Treviso-Belluno|Dolomiti and the participation of Confartigianato Imprese Veneto, Vie Maestre was created to guide tourists, enthusiasts, and mindful travelers through territories rich in history, culture, and craftsmanship—where landscape and enterprise constantly dialogue.

The project unfolds along two extraordinary walking and cycling routes: the Treviso-Ostiglia, built on a former railway line, and the Sentiero degli Ezzelini, which follows the courses of the Muson and Lastego rivers to the foothills of Mount Grappa. Two green corridors that create an ideal link between nature, art, and craftsmanship. The initiative involves several municipalities across the Marca Trevigiana—including Treviso, Castelfranco Veneto, and Asolo—and promotes experiences that highlight quality hospitality, authentic relationships, and the value of artisanal work. Workshops, studios, and small ateliers become essential stops in a narrative where every object tells a story, every gesture carries tradition, and every place reveals a unique identity.

The very name Vie Maestre recalls the old roads that once connected towns to their rural surroundings and artisan quarters—both physical and symbolic paths that today become experiential itineraries to discover a more intimate, creative, and surprising Veneto.
